Turkish, US Defense Ministers hold telephone conversation

Turkish National Defense Minister Hulusi Akar had a telephone conversation with Pentagon chief Lloyd Austin, Report informs, citing Anadolu.
Turkish and US defense ministers discussed security in the region. The parties also considered opportunities for bilateral cooperation in the field of defense.
Hulusi Akar and Lloyd Austin stressed the importance of strategic relations between Turkey and the United States, emphasizing the importance of resolving all issues in the spirit of partnership and alliance. The sides reiterated the importance of promoting cooperation and closely coordinating the two countries' steps in the defense.
